Turkey has closed the Dardanelles strait to shipping traffic due to forest fires in the area. The country’s ministry of transport told The National that traffic had been “temporarily suspended in both directions due to the fires in Canakkale”. An official was unable to confirm a schedule from the ministry’s directorate of coastal safety which suggested the closure would continue until midnight. A regional governor said firefighters were working from air and land to tackle the rural fires. More than a dozen people in Turkey have been killed amid fires and searing summer temperatures over recent weeks.
